Key concepts and overview
Slot reels are the core component of any slot machine, whether physical or digital. They consist of a series of symbols that spin and stop to create winning combinations. The variety in slot games largely stems from the different configurations and mechanics of these reels. Traditional slots typically feature three reels, while modern video slots can have five or more. Additionally, the introduction of features such as cascading reels, expanding wilds, and bonus rounds has further diversified gameplay. Main features and details
The functionality of slot reels can be broken down into several key components:
- Reel Configuration: The number of reels and rows can significantly impact the game’s complexity and potential payouts. More reels often mean more ways to win.
- Symbol Variety: Different symbols can trigger various bonuses or multipliers, adding layers to the gameplay. Unique symbols can also enhance the theme of the game.
- Paylines: The lines on which players can win are crucial. Traditional slots may have a single payline, while modern games can feature hundreds or even thousands of ways to win.
- Bonus Features: Many slots include special features that activate under certain conditions, such as free spins or mini-games, which can lead to increased player engagement.
These features not only create variety but also keep players returning for more, as each game offers a unique experience.
